Fernando Santos ex head coach of Portugal and other squads, now is not longer coach of Besiktas

The 69-year-old Portuguese coach took over the City team on January 7, 2024 and on 4/13 the divorce was announced.


Santos, were already in a difficult position and the new 1-1 home draw with Samsunspor, in the context of the 32nd game, was the last straw. Besiktas had 5 matches in a row without a win and in these they got only two points.


The "eagles" are in fourth place and -4 behind the third-placed Trabzonspor, while they are 36 points from the leader Galata (48 against 84) and 34 points from the second-placed Fenerbahce. The fans were calling for his dismissal or resignation at the end of the match against Samsunspor.


So, the management did not take long to announce the divorce.


There was a hot development in the black and white club. After the meeting between the president of Besiktas Hasan Arat and some members of the board, the club in a statement emphasizes that it has parted ways with Fernando Santos.


"We thank Santos for his services and wish him success in the future. Sernat Topraktepe (U19 coach) will be in charge of the first team until the end of the season."


During his time at Besiktas, Santos sat on the bench in just 13 matches and his record was 7 wins, 4 draws and 5 losses.


Finally,  Santos, who had agreed for 1.5 years, he will receive compensation of 500,000 euros from Besiktas.
